Six year-old Sebastian is called on as a last minute substitute for the Announcing Angel in the Easter Pageant presented at his church on Easter morning. All he has to do is roll back the stone, sit on it, and announce, "He is not here He has risen " Lest you think that sounds easy, consider that Sebastian is six years old, he hasn't rehearsed this play with the adult actors, his costume is pinned-to-fit, and his wings hang down to his bottom. But Sebastian knows this is the cameo of his life - the Announcing Angel in the Easter Pageant. Sebastian and his friends have already staged their interpretation of the Easter story in their back yard, but this is the real thing. His brother is playing Jesus, it's in front of the whole church, and since Sebastian already knows the story, his mother has volunteered him to replace the sick Announcing Angel. Arriving backstage just before the crucifixion scene, Sebastian is immediately caught up in the realistic drama. Then his mother gives him a little push and says, "Remember, He is not here He is risen " How Sebastian carries out his part, and the startling discovery he makes is sure to amuse and delight both children and the adults who read to them. Written with light, humorous, and visual charm, Sebastian, the Substitute Angel is aimed at ages 10 and up as it honestly and simply proclaims the Good News of Jesus Christ, sometimes though the eyes of the adult, and sometimes through the exuberance of the child.

Pauline Youd lives in the central valley of California with her husband and cat. Her family of three adult married children and their families all live in the Western states. Her hobbies include music (classical, jazz and oldies) and playing in the yard (gardening). Prior to her writing career, she studied music in college and sang leading roles with Starlight of Kern, a light opera company in Bakersfield, California. A former third grade public school teacher and an avid Bible student, she has written 28 Bible story books. Her preschool titles are Did You Know? a creation story, and The Little Book of Big Bible Scaries. Her "I Wonder..." series of 12 books including Why Was Daniel Scared? is targeted to ages 4 to 7. Her original series, For a Purpose, includes Adopted for a Purpose and four other titles and is written for ages 8 to 12. The 7 Days series including 7 Days with Balaam is for adults. Her favorite titles are In the Court of the King, Eight Stories from the Book of Daniel, and Bible Runaways.
